Released in 2010, Mafia II (developed by 2K Czech) remains a beloved open-world action game, praised for its narrative depth and atmospheric recreation of the 1940s–1950s American underworld. However, the game’s post-launch downloadable content (DLC)— Jimmy’s Vendetta , Jimmy’s Revolution , and Joe’s Adventures —was not seamlessly integrated into the main story mode. Players could only access DLC content through separate menu options, limiting gameplay flexibility. Furthermore, the game’s modding scene faced technical restrictions due to how the engine handled DLC assets. Enter the a community-created utility designed to bypass these limitations. Ethics beyond law Even setting legality aside, there’s an ethical layer worth pondering. Modding communities often operate on reciprocity: creators share, users credit, and a patchwork morale governs behavior. When an enabler lets orphaned content live again, it can be a moral good: players regain control of what they once paid for; historical game elements aren’t lost to corporate churn. But when that same tool becomes a vehicle for circulating paid content freely, the balance shifts—creators and teams who once poured labor into DLC deserve recognition and compensation too.
